8 //
9 // This file defines utilities for operating on streams that have endian
10 // specific data.
11 //
12 //===----------------------------------------------------------------------===//
13
14 #ifndef LLVM_SUPPORT_ENDIANSTREAM_H
15 #define LLVM_SUPPORT_ENDIANSTREAM_H
16
17 #include "llvm/ADT/ArrayRef.h"
18 #include "llvm/Support/Endian.h"
19 #include "llvm/Support/raw_ostream.h"
20
21 namespace llvm {
22 namespace support {
23
24 namespace endian {
25
26 template <typename value_type>
write(raw_ostream & os,value_type value,endianness endian)27 inline void write(raw_ostream &os, value_type value, endianness endian) {
28 value = byte_swap<value_type>(value, endian);
29 os.write((const char *)&value, sizeof(value_type));
30 }
31
32 template <>
33 inline void write<float>(raw_ostream &os, float value, endianness endian) {
34 write(os, FloatToBits(value), endian);
35 }
36
37 template <>
38 inline void write<double>(raw_ostream &os, double value,
39 endianness endian) {
40 write(os, DoubleToBits(value), endian);
41 }
42
43 template <typename value_type>
write(raw_ostream & os,ArrayRef<value_type> vals,endianness endian)44 inline void write(raw_ostream &os, ArrayRef<value_type> vals,
45 endianness endian) {
46 for (value_type v : vals)
47 write(os, v, endian);
48 }
49
50 /// Adapter to write values to a stream in a particular byte order.
51 struct Writer {
52 raw_ostream &OS;
53 endianness Endian;
WriterWriter54 Writer(raw_ostream &OS, endianness Endian) : OS(OS), Endian(Endian) {}
writeWriter55 template <typename value_type> void write(ArrayRef<value_type> Val) {
56 endian::write(OS, Val, Endian);
57 }
writeWriter58 template <typename value_type> void write(value_type Val) {
59 endian::write(OS, Val, Endian);
60 }
61 };
62
63 } // end namespace endian
64
65 } // end namespace support
66 } // end namespace llvm
67
68 #endif
